This film and associated education campaign played a pivotal role in the unanimous bipartisan passage of the Florida Wildlife Corridor Act in 2021, a critical step to secure Florida’s unique wild places and the animals that call them home.
This milestone was the result of an extensive, strategic communications campaign by Wildpath and partners. Special screenings of the film were held for the Florida Legislature, followed by a theatrical release in more than 40 theaters across the state in 2023. The book, “Path of the Panther: New Hope for Wild Florida” — which won the Florida Book Award in 2023 for nonfiction — was also distributed to every state lawmaker. A series of photo exhibits held in Florida and Washington, D.C., a feature-length article in National Geographic magazine, and a K-12 education curriculum designed for students further helped grow the movement to protect the Florida Wildlife Corridor; in 2023, Florida committed $1billion to land protection within the corridor. The Florida Senate also recognized April 22, 2025 as Florida Wildlife Corridor Day.
